The Internet familiar to us (the tip of the "Internet iceberg") is only a small part of the entire Web space. It is called "TheSurfaceWeb" - "Internet on the surface", or ClearNet. Sites in this segment are indexed by search engines, and their share is approximately 4%.
The remaining 96% is the invisible part, or "DeepWeb" - "deep" Internet. This includes data owned by companies, government agencies, scientific and medical centers, the military, etc. Information in this segment is not indexed. The lower part of the "Internet iceberg" is "DarkNet" - "shadow" Internet, access to which is carried out using specialized software.
In recent years, the activity of cybercriminals has increased significantly: the emergence of "black markets" in the DarkNet contributed to the spread of malware, as well as tools and methods to bypass fraud monitoring. Alas, he knows: if in the past he needed many years of experience to carry out a cyber attack, now many tools are available in the form of step-by-step guides, and for a small fee!
For example, pricing studies on the "black market" DarkNet show that a significant set of tools for cyber attacks (malware, ready-made phishing pages, password crackers, etc.) can be purchased for just a few dollars. A team of researchers studied thousands of ads in the five largest DarkNet black markets and compiled the Dark Web Market Price Index. The results obtained show that the cost of a cyberattack has become much more affordable, and the barriers to entry that existed before have practically disappeared.
Another significant factor for the development of the "black market" was the emergence of cryptocurrencies. Digital coins, especially BitCoin, are very popular in many services of the "shadow" Internet. They act as the main payment instrument, as buyers and sellers strive to achieve maximum anonymity. The emergence of cryptocurrencies has given a new breath to the "black markets" in the DarkNet.
